Output 8a6f5d115867f31a106a5ddc923fceb9f90313340cb9e0f5426e36e9611fa839:0

value
157368011
script pubkey
OP_0 OP_PUSHBYTES_32 321b40c968eb96ecbad88cc7dc9955329384f4dc98baa8c8020917841fad0a05
address
bc1qxgd5pjtgawtwewkc3nraex24x2fcfaxunza23jqzpytcg8adpgzstwxj6c
transaction
8a6f5d115867f31a106a5ddc923fceb9f90313340cb9e0f5426e36e9611fa839
spent
true